  Your Role:

  Are you ready to take the next step in your career? Do you want to do meaningful work that improves quality of life? At Tetra Tech, you will work with high-performing teams who are passionate about using their expertise to find solutions to complex problems in water, environment, infrastructure, resource management, energy, and international development.

  Tetra Tech, Inc. is seeking a Project Scientist for our Indianapolis, IN location with 1-5 years of experience to provide support on a variety of complex and interesting environmental projects, including emergency response with on-call support and significant travel opportunity. This position will involve providing technical support in the areas of emergency response, environmental investigation, and remediation. Members of the emergency response team are responsible for maintaining on-call readiness to handle emergency responses and provide remedial and restoration guidance/solutions to clients throughout the Midwest and across the United States, including the oversight of site operations and health and safety.

  Responsibilities will include multi-media environmental sampling, field audits and inspections, organizing and reviewing data, preparing reports, records review, collection of air monitoring data, training and exercise support, contractor oversight, and related activities. Additional responsibilities and opportunities may include task and project management, conducting training presentations, preparation of statements of qualifications and proposals, and other consulting activities for a variety of government and private sector clients.

  In this position you will be part of a project team, gaining valuable data collection experience in the field and preparing detailed analysis of field data and project reports. Tetra Tech provides mentoring and training opportunities to help staff develop their skills and diversify their experience and interests.

  Qualifications:

  Candidates should have 1-5 years of experience in environmental consulting, hazardous materials response, or related activities. Desired skills in the ideal candidate include but are not limited to:

  Emergency response, knowledge of federal and state environmental regulations and remediation management experience and the ability to respond quickly within a mandatory response time preferred.Experience with hazardous waste site investigation and field sampling, feasibility studies, remedial design, site remediation, air quality, ecological restoration, and water resources desirable.Previous experience working on EPA projects a plus.Must be customer focused and work well in a team environment.Must also have effective time management and organizational skills as well as the ability travel and be on-call as needed.Excellent technical writing and communication skills, as well as proficiency with MS Office applications are required.GIS data analysis and geostatistics, coding (VBA, Python, etc.), and data management skills a plus.In addition, this position requires:

  Driving on a regular basis, therefore, passing a motor vehicle record background check.Maintaining a valid driver's license and good driving record.Passing a criminal background check.Education:

  Bachelor's degree in environmental science, geo ogy, or related physical science required.40-Hour OSHA HAZWOPER, ICS or related training, or demonstrated first responder (environmental emergency response) experience preferred.Asbestos certification preferred.Physical Demands:

  Heavy lifting of field sampling and other equipment will be required.Meeting physical demands of hazardous waste site work required.Work Environment:

  Primary work environments are office and field, with remote hybrid work flexibility depending on project requirements.Occasional travel to client sites and other locations to conduct meetings, site visits, field work, etc. will be required. These sites may be outdoors, exposing the candidate to weather conditions and varying terrain.Occasional evening and/or weekend work will be required.About Tetra Tech:
